SM launches voter registration centers
CITY OF SAN FERNANDO---The Commission on Elections and SM Supermalls recently launched 76 satellite Commission on Elections (Comelec) Voter Registration centers at the SM Supermalls to provide voters with more registration venues.
This will run in SM Supermalls nationwide until September 30. This gives the public a safer, more convenient option amidst the prevailing COVID health crisis.
Leading the launch at SM Mall of Asia were Comelec Commissioner Aimee Ferolino joined by Comelec Director IV for Election and Barangay Affairs Department Atty. Divine E. Blas-Perez, Comelec Director IV for Education and Information James Jimenez, SM Supermalls President Steven Tan and SM Supermalls SVP for Operations Bien Mateo.
SM Supermalls is providing free space and waived charges to essential conveniences so they can efficiently operate the registration centers. (PR)
